WebSep 22, 2024 · On August 22, 1976, Molly gives birth to the couple's third child, a son named Percy Ignatius Weasley. On April 1, 1978, Molly gives birth to twin sons, Fred and George. Fred is the fourth child of the Weasleys, while George is the fifth. In mid-1979, Molly learns that she's pregnant again.
